Portfolio Variance and Correlation Matrices
The fact that portfolio variance must be positive implies that the correlation matrix for asset returns should be positive definite. As such, a test for positive definiteness in the correlation matrix should be routinely implemented prior to any portfolio optimization exercise. Asset Allocation in a Downside Risk Framework
The traditional Markowitz portfolio optimization has two serious drawbacks. First, mean-variance portfolio optimization is inadequate when asset returns are skewed.
